On June 20, 1986, The Prince’s Trust celebrated its 10th anniversary with a concert at London’s Wembley Arena. Eric Clapton & Tina used this platform to introduce their new song, ”Tearing Us Apart,” which would appear later in the year on Clapton’s August album.![]()
Eric Clapton was the first superstar to sign on to the anniversary Rock Gala. He was quickly followed by other legendary musicians, including Paul McCartney, George Harrison, Bryan Adams, Mark Knopfler, Phil Collins and Tina Turner.
The event became a once-in-a-lifetime collaboration among friends and fellow musicians that has rarely been matched.
These collaborations have become one of the hallmarks of the various music concerts organized by The Trust
One of the highlights of the 1986 All-Star Gala was the first live duet performance by Clapton and Tina Turner of their recently recorded song for Clapton’s 1986 August album—“Tearing Us Apart. ” The song was co-written by Clapton and Greg Phillinganes, and was produced by Phil Collins, who joins Clapton and Tina Turner on stage with “all-star” band members Bryan Adams and Mark Knopfler,
Clapton makes it clear in his autobiography that this song was inspired by a painful series of events in his relationship with photographer and model Pattie Boyd. The song is part of Clapton’s return to his R&B roots, and many critics have paid tribute to Tearing Us Apart as Clapton at his “angry best.” The success of the August album and the single Tearing Us Apart (which went quickly to #5 on the UK’s Rock Chart) resulted in a collaboration with Phil Collins that would continue for years.

Eric Clapton was an early supporter of The Prince's Trust charity "Rock Galas"
Both Clapton and Tina Turner continue to perform this song at their concerts…at times with each other; at times with others (Clapton has performed this song with the likes of Katie Kissoon, Tess Niles, and Sheryl Crow). But The Prince’s Trust concert was the very first venue for a live performance of Tearing Us Apart, and the combination of Turner, Clapton and Collins makes this a true snapshot of the creative energy that was behind the making of the song.
HRH The Prince of Wales founded The Prince’s Trust in 1976 out of a conviction that a way should be found to tackle the alienation of many young people in society by encouraging challenge, adventure and self-help.
The Prince’s Trust is UK’s leading youth charity, giving practical and financial support to 14-30 year olds, helping them tackle problems of employment, education and training. Since its inception in 1976 The Trust has helped over 600,000 young people, overcome their barriers and transform their lives.
